The rules of bingo vary somewhat from site to site, but here are some general rules every player should know:
A bingo card has twenty-four numbers and one free space that are arranged in a grid. There are five lines across and five columns down. Above the five columns of numbers, the word bingo is spelled out, with one letter above each column. At random, numbers are drawn from one to seventy-five. The letters under the B are from 1-15, 16-30 under the I, 31-45 under the N, plus a free space, 46-60 under the G, and 61-75 under the O. The free space is covered before the game begins and is a freebie to help the player along. The number would be called out as B12, I27, N38, and etc. As each number is called, if the player has the number on their card, they mark, or daub, the space.
This continues until the player has covered the required pattern needed for a win. These patterns can vary from game to game. The most common pattern is to cover a line all the way across or a column all the way down. All sorts of patterns are played in bingo. Be sure to familiarize yourself with the pattern required for a win before you begin the game.
When the player has covered the required pattern, they win. In a real bingo hall, they would yell “BINGO” loud enough for the caller or spotter to hear. Most bingo halls require the player to yell bingo before the next number is called or they will forfeit the card and the game. In most online sites, the player hits the “BINGO” button, telling the site who the game. Some sites are now auto daubing cards and will automatically call bingo for the player. In all bingo games, all players who have completed the pattern on the card at the same time, with the same number called, will win, after the card is verified. The card is usually verified immediately at the online sites. In a bingo hall, the winning pattern is verified by the bingo caller. The players that win will either split the jackpot equally or will receive the total jackpot.
Bingo is a very simple game to play, but it has many variations. Make sure you understand the rules to the specific game you are playing. Good Luck!

Did you know that …

... there are two types of bingo played around the world?

North America plays 75-ball bingo on a 5x5 card with the centre square usually marked 'free'. In the UK, parts of Europe, Australia and parts of South America they play a 90-ball game, marked on a 9x3 card. Both types of bingo are prominent online.

Unlike balls used in regular bingo halls, online bingo sites use a random number generator. The online bingo play works almost exactly like playing online poker or online casino games with everything being virtual. Most bingo halls also offer links to online poker and casino offerings. One notable feature of online bingo is the chat functionality that gives the opportunity to interact with other players.

Progressive jackpot bingo games offer high value cash prizes. The jackpot is accumulated over a period of time, often taken from payments made to play smaller games. Usually as each new card pattern emerges, the pattern will have a number defining the amount of calls needed to claim the Jackpot. If players obtain a Bingo in this amount of calls or less then they will win the Progressive Jackpot. But rules are different for the different online bingo halls, so check before playing.
